Module ISSUES & DEBATES IN PSYCHOLOGY

Module code: PS654
Credits: 5
Semester: 2
Department: PSYCHOLOGY
International: No
Coordinator: Dr Michael Cooke (PSYCHOLOGY)
Overview Overview
 

Psychology as a Science; Fundamental assumptions in psychology; Its definitions, subject matter and impacts;
Psychology in the Tree of knowledge;
Psychology & Politics;
Contradictions, paradoxes, and conflicts in psychology;
Critical approaches to psychology;
The distinction between science and pseudo-science, and its relevance for psychology;
Fundamental assumptions in psychology – its definitions, subject matter and impacts;
Philosophy of science for psychology;
Paradigms and approaches to psychological enquiry;
The relationship between psychology and culture;
Insights from modern philosophy for psychology;
What psychology can learn from other disciplines (social and natural sciences, and humanities);
Public perceptions of and misconceptions about psychology;
